    Quote Originally Posted by JokerR
    12.26 at selection, need to get out more, but i have trouble motivating myself to run, anyone got any tips ?
    Had the same problem. Used to go out for runs in the evening but was finding it pretty hard to get myself motivated after a days work when you just wanna kick back and relax. I switched to going out on short runs 4 times a day - to work, home for lunch and back to work then home again at the end of the day. Covered about 1.5 km with each run at a fairly relaxed pace - about 10 mins each time.

    Topped this up with a more serious work out twice a week with a 4.5 km run, an hour of football and another 4.5km run on Tuesdays and then on Saturdays 2.4km at a relaxed pace followed by timed 2.4km best effort and then a casual jog around town to warm down.
